Imaging, Vision and Pattern Recognition (IVPR)

About us

Image Processing, Computer Vision and Pattern Recognition constitute a fascinating area of research. In IVPR group at ETCE-JU, we are interested in both theoretical and practical aspects of the above fields.

As part of theoretical developments, we are exploring Graph-based modeling (graph cuts, graph matching, detection of shortest paths, optimum path forest, Spectral graph theory and Delaunay graphs), various statistical techniques (Particle filtering, non-parametric estimations and mixture models), PDEs (level sets) and techniques from signal theory (Fourier Transform, Hilbert Transform, Steerable maps).

On the application side, we are working on Multimedia analysis (video summarization and movie scene detection), Target tracking (pedestrian tracking, tracking of human monocyte cells and muscle stem cells), Medical image segmentation (segmentation of kidney, retinal blood vessels, cerebral white matter and blood vessels near the pancreas in zebra-fish), Medical image registration (registration of retinal images and brain MRI images), Computer aided detection (detection of pelvic fractures), Bio-metric authentication (subject invariant gait recognition from silhouettes) and Image Fusion (across different spectra).
